嘿,小伙伴们,是不是有时候想连接到一个WiFi网络,但又不想去麻烦地获取root权限呢?今天就来和大家分享一个不用root就能破解WiFi密码的方法,并且还会教大家如何轻松安装。让我们一步步来探索这个神奇的技巧吧!
了解WiFi密码破解的基本原理
在开始之前,我们先来了解一下WiFi密码破解的基本原理。通常情况下,破解WiFi密码需要用到一些专门的工具,这些工具可能需要root权限来执行某些操作。但是,现在有一些方法可以在不root的情况下实现这个目标。
安装WiFi密码破解工具
1. 下载破解工具
首先,我们需要一个破解工具。这里推荐使用Aircrack-ng,这是一个非常强大的无线网络安全工具,能够帮助破解WEP、WPA、WPA2等加密的WiFi密码。
你可以在以下链接下载Aircrack-ng的最新版本:
2. 安装Aircrack-ng
由于我们不使用root权限,所以我们需要使用sudo来获取超级用户的权限。以下是在Linux系统中安装Aircrack-ng的步骤:
sudo apt-get update
sudo apt-get install aircrack-ng
如果你使用的是Mac OS,可以使用Homebrew来安装:
brew install aircrack-ng
3. 配置无线网卡
在开始破解WiFi密码之前,需要确保你的无线网卡处于监控模式(monitor mode)。以下是在Linux系统中配置无线网卡的步骤:
sudo ifconfig wlan0 down
sudo iwconfig wlan0 mode monitor
sudo ifconfig wlan0 up
请注意,以上命令中的wlan0可能需要根据你的无线网卡名称进行修改。
破解WiFi密码
现在我们已经安装了Aircrack-ng并且配置了无线网卡,接下来就可以开始破解WiFi密码了。
1. 扫描WiFi网络
使用以下命令扫描周围的WiFi网络:
airodump-ng wlan0
2. 选择目标网络
在扫描结果中,找到你想要破解的WiFi网络,记录下它的BSSID(通常是最后一列)。
3. 收集数据包
选择目标网络后,我们需要收集足够的数据包来破解密码。以下命令将开始收集数据包:
airodump-ng wlan0 -c <频道号> -bssid <BSSID>
其中<频道号>是你选择网络的频道,<BSSID>是目标网络的MAC地址。
4. 破解密码
当收集到足够的数据包后,使用以下命令进行破解:
aircrack-ng wlan0.cap
其中wlan0.cap是刚才收集到的数据包文件。
注意事项
- 使用WiFi破解工具可能违反法律和道德规范,请确保在合法范围内使用。
- 破解WiFi密码前,请确保你拥有该网络的合法访问权限。
- 破解过程可能会被网络管理员检测到,请谨慎操作。
希望这篇教程能帮助你轻松破解WiFi密码。如果你在操作过程中遇到任何问题,欢迎在评论区留言,我会尽力帮助你解决问题。安全上网,从你我做起!
